Subsequent SMB volumes are VERY slow to mount

I mount a SMB server volume and it mounts very quickly and is perfectly fine. But every subsequent volume I mount from the same server takes up to a minute to mount. It happens as guest and as authenticated user, and whether or not the password has been saved in the keychain. I have two Win 2003 servers and the same happens on both.

Interestingly I have ExtremeZ-IP running on one of the servers and I have no such issues connecting via those volumes - all volumes mount straight away.

It's not the end of the world but it shouldn't happen and I have four volumes set to mount at login on one particular server so I'd like to sort it if i can.

Anyone have any ideas?
